package render
import (
"context"
"strings"
"github.com/henderiw/logger/log"
)
type Renderer interface {
Render(ctx context.Context, x any) (any, error)
}
func New(renderFn RenderFn, stringFn StringFn) Renderer {
return &commonRenderer{
RenderFn: renderFn,
StringFn: stringFn,
}
}
type RenderFn func(ctx context.Context, x any) (any, error)
type StringFn func(ctx context.Context, x string) (any, error)
type commonRenderer struct {
RenderFn func(ctx context.Context, x any) (any, error)
StringFn func(ctx context.Context, x string) (any, error)
}
func (r *commonRenderer) Render(ctx context.Context, x any) (any, error) {
log := log.FromContext(ctx)
var err error
switch x := x.(type) {
case map[string]any:
for k, v := range x {
if r.RenderFn != nil {
x[k], err = r.RenderFn(ctx, v)
if err != nil {
log.Debug("render map[string]any", "err", err.Error())
// this is to handle cell rendering
if strings.Contains(err.Error(), "no such key") || strings.Contains(err.Error(), "not found") {
delete(x, k)
continue
} else {
return nil, err
}
}
}
}
case []any:
newv := []any{}
for i, v := range x {
// rather then deleting the entry when the rendering failed harmlessly
// -> add the entry to a new list (newx)
if r.RenderFn != nil {
newx, err := r.RenderFn(ctx, v)
if err != nil {
log.Info("render []any", "err", err.Error())
if strings.Contains(err.Error(), "no such key") || strings.Contains(err.Error(), "not found") {
x[i] = nil
continue
} else {
return nil, err
}
}
newv = append(newv, newx)
}
}
return newv, nil
case string:
if r.StringFn != nil {
return r.StringFn(ctx, x)
}
default:
}
return x, nil
}
